Taxonomic Classification

Rank Cascade Chanterelle Gerenuk
Kingdom Fungi (Fungi) Animalia (Animals)
Phylum Basidiomycota (Club Fungi) Chordata (Chordates)
Class Agaricomycetes (Mushrooms) Mammalia (Mammals)
Order Cantharellales (Cantharellales) Artiodactyla (Even-toed Ungulates)
Family Hydnaceae Bovidae (Bovids)
Genus Cantharellus Litocranius
Species Cantharellus cascadensis Litocranius walleri
